#483e6c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#483e6c is composed of 28.2% red, 24.3%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.3% cyan, 42.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 253 degrees, a saturation of 27.1% and a lightness of 33.3%. #483e6c color hex could be obtained by blending #907cd8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#483e6c color description : Very dark desaturated blue.

#483e6c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#483e6c has RGB values of R:72, G:62, B:108 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 4734572.

Shades and Tints of #483e6c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060508 is the darkest color, while #fbfb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#483e6c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#535258 is the less saturated color, while #2703a7 is the most saturated one.
